Say what you want about Jennifer Lopez as a vocalist, but there is no denying, the superstar puts on one hell of a show, which was more than evident at her recent set at 'Chime For Change: The Sound of Change' in London.
For her energetic set, the 43-year-old entertainer performed her biggest hits, including "Love Don't Cost A Thing" and "On the Floor", in addition to, teaming up with Mary J. Blige for a duet of The Beatles' classic hit, "Come Together".
While the duet fell flat from a vocal standpoint, the mere image of getting to see two superstars of different genres come together on stage for a good cause overrides the fact that one can't sing (Lopez) and one is rarely in tune (Blige). Watch beneath:
